In a strange twist of fate, Ranbeer Talwar (Saif Ali Khan), a leading industrialist, finds himself responsible for the welfare of four orphaned children after a tragic accident claims their parents. The children, however, hold Ranbeer responsible for their loss and make his life miserable with their pranks and disdain.
